Moreover, Grunin’s recent public statements contradict hisclaim that this lawsuit has hampered his lifestyle or compromised his personal relationships.On November 21. 2014, Grunin posted a message on Reddit.com detailing the demise of his relationship with his girlfriend of 9 years. Jennison Declaration, Exh. A and overview for mgrunin. In the post, Grunin recountsnumerous reasons his relationship failed and the claims by Facebook are not among them. The difference between Grunin’s public statements and statements to the court are further evidence that Grunin continues to ignore the seriousness of his actions. Significant punitive damages are appropriate here.


Grunin’s actions required much more work on the part of Facebook’s legal team than would be the case in the typical default. The “representation” by a non-lawyer, the repeated bogus filings, and the motion to set aside default all compounded the work required to prosecute the case. Accordingly, Grunin has not effectively challenged Facebook’s request for fees.
